Accelerated Curriculum: Fast-Track Your Nursing Education
In today’s fast-paced world, many aspiring nurses are seeking efficient ways to fast-track their education and enter the healthcare field promptly. This is where accelerated nursing degree programs step in as a game-changer. These innovative programs are designed to compress the traditional learning curve into a more concise timeline, allowing students to earn their degrees in a fraction of the usual time. The curriculum for these quick nursing degrees is meticulously crafted to deliver essential knowledge and practical skills, ensuring graduates are well-prepared for their roles.
By enrolling in an online BSN (Bachelor of Science in Nursing) or accelerated BSCN (also known as accelerated BSN), students can gain access to comprehensive bedside nursing training while managing their studies at their own pace. These programs often incorporate flexible learning formats, including online lectures, interactive modules, and hands-on simulations, enabling future nurses to acquire the necessary qualifications without sacrificing personal responsibilities or work commitments.

Clinical Experience: Preparing for Real-World Healthcare Settings
Clinical experience is a cornerstone of any nursing degree program, but it becomes especially vital in quick nursing degree courses. These programs are designed to be efficient, often compressing traditional coursework into a shorter duration like 30 months. To prepare students for real-world healthcare settings, clinical placements are integral, offering hands-on learning experiences that mimic the fast-paced and unpredictable nature of patient care. Students gain confidence in assessing patients, administering medication, and providing various nursing interventions under professional supervision.
The clinical component not only equips aspiring nurses with practical skills but also fosters an understanding of ethical considerations and communication strategies essential for effective patient management. These experiences contribute to the overall nursing academic excellence, ensuring graduates are well-prepared to pursue diverse nursing career opportunities upon completion of their quick nursing degree.
